Modern Technology in Agriculture: A Sustainable Future

Agriculture, the industry that feeds humanity, is undergoing an unprecedented technological revolution. From traditional fields to smart farms, technology is playing a crucial role in improving productivity, product quality, and environmental protection.

Applications of Information Technology in Agriculture

Big Data and Artificial Intelligence (AI): Sensor systems and drones collect data on soil, crops, and weather, helping farmers make informed decisions and optimize the farming process. AI analyzes data to predict yields, detect pests and diseases in a timely manner, contributing to risk reduction and increased production efficiency.

Internet of Things (IoT): Connecting agricultural equipment such as automated irrigation systems and smart farming machinery creates a remote monitoring and control network. This helps farmers save time, effort, and resources.

Global Positioning System (GPS): Provides accurate location information to help machinery operate efficiently, optimizing fertilization, spraying, and harvesting processes.

Sustainable Farming and Environmental Protection

Technology helps agriculture move towards sustainable development goals. Precision Farming helps reduce the use of fertilizers and pesticides, saving water, protecting the environment and human health. The application of technology also helps reduce pollution from agricultural activities.

Challenges and Solutions

Despite its potential, the application of technology in agriculture faces challenges: high investment costs, lack of skilled labor, and poor internet connectivity in rural areas. To address these challenges, support from governments, international organizations, and close cooperation between stakeholders is needed.
